Unfortunately, Arnie was born with a rare heart condition and had to undergo multiple heart surgeries. He was diagnosed with a congenital heart defect that made it difficult for the heart to pump blood. The legend had to undergo valve replacement surgeries. However, he once revealed how these surgeries had benefited him.

Arnold Schwarzenegger opened up about energy levels after surgery

In an interview, the Austrian Oak spoke about his acting stint while recovering from surgery. As an actor, Arnold performed stunts that put him at high risk. But turns out, the legend was more than happy to be doing his work. He revealed how his energy levels improved after the surgery. The star also felt the difference since he grew up with low energy levels. He explained, “It was a problem I had from birth so I never knew that I was lacking some energy.

While going through a valve replacement isn’t easy on the body, Arnold made it look like a cakewalk. He preferred doing stunts and physical action. Therefore, the surgery and its benefits played out well for him. In fact, his surgeon added that his energy levels will be boosted by 1/5th of what he previously had.
